Wellness Risks of Biohazard Exposure



Exposure to biohazards poses considerable health dangers that can lead to extreme repercussions for people and communities alike. Biohazards include a wide variety of organic compounds, including blood, bodily fluids, mold, microorganisms, viruses, and various other possibly infectious materials. When people come into contact with these biohazards, whether with crashes, incorrect handling, or environmental direct exposure, they deal with the danger of having severe diseases or illness.


Among the key health and wellness dangers related to biohazard exposure is the transmission of infectious illness. Bloodborne virus such as HIV, hepatitis B and C, and different germs can be existing in biohazardous products, posing a direct hazard to human wellness. Inhaling airborne biohazards like mold spores or entering into call with infected surface areas can also cause respiratory issues, allergies, and other adverse health and wellness results.


Moreover, biohazard direct exposure can have lasting health implications, with some conditions materializing years after the first get in touch with (Blood Cleanup). For that reason, it is crucial to prioritize proper biohazard cleaning and decontamination to mitigate these health and wellness risks and make sure the safety and security of communities and individuals

Tools and Devices for Safe Cleaning



The correct devices and devices play a vital function in making sure the secure and reliable cleaning of biohazardous products. When handling blood, bodily fluids, or dangerous materials, biohazard cleaning experts count on specialized equipment to lessen exposure risks and thoroughly sanitize the affected area. Individual safety tools (PPE) such as handwear covers, coveralls, masks, and goggles are vital to safeguard against direct call with possibly infectious products. Furthermore, biohazard cleaning packages having anti-bacterials, absorptive materials, and biohazard bags are made use of to securely consist of and dispose of polluted items. Blood Cleanup.


Advanced cleaning devices like hospital-grade anti-bacterials, HEPA-filtered vacuums, and misting devices are used to sanitize surface areas and remove biohazards successfully. Specialized equipment such as sharps containers and biohazard garbage disposal containers are used to securely handle sharp objects and biohazardous waste materials. Regulations and Compliance in Biohazard Cleaning



Correct adherence to guidelines and compliance requirements is paramount in biohazard cleaning to make sure the safety and security of both personnel and the atmosphere. Federal government firms such as OSHA (Occupational Security and Wellness Management) and the EPA (Epa) have actually developed specific guidelines for biohazard cleanup procedures to reduce health and wellness dangers and ecological contamination. These guidelines cover a variety of facets consisting of the handling, transportation, and disposal of biohazardous materials, as well as the required training and protective equipment needed for employees involved in the clean-up procedure.


Biohazard cleansing firms have to remain updated with these guidelines to ensure that their procedures satisfy the needed security requirements. Failing to adhere to these regulations can cause extreme consequences, including penalties, lawful activity, and threatening the wellness of people and the setting.
